SHANNON ATHLETIC CLUB.
Last evening the committee of the Shannon Amateur Athletic and Cycling CM> met to receive the report of the deputation wdio waited on the Borough Council for the purpose of discussing the laying down of a cy cl'e track on the Domain. Mr Whyte reported thait the Council had agreed, to allow from the Domain Fund £6O towards the work, providing tine Glu/b assisted .with the work. This was considered very satisfactory. . Messrs Curran, Bovis, and Moynihan were appointed to meet the Surveyor to arrange laying out the cycle track and football ground. A finance committee consisting of Messrs J. Curran and Brann, and Dr. Maokereth were appointed. it was decided to add to the programme a five mile cycle race. A suggestion was also made tat a gold medal be awarded to the winner of the most points in the cycle events, but nothiipg 1 was, done in this direction. The following officials were appointed: Handicapper and starter for the cycle, running and field events, Mt G. Watsons handicapper wood chopping and sawiing events, Mr Val Croon; starter, Mr Jas. Hallam; official time-keeper, Mr .T. Whyte (Toko- j inaru). ,
